Summary:
The more engaged users are, the more features an application can sustain.
But most users have low commitment -- especially to websites, which must
focus on simplicity, rather than features.

TANGIBLE MEDIA BECOME REAL

Toymaker Fisher-Price has introduced an interaction device to help
toddlers access websites without typing.

To use the "Easy Link Internet Launch Pad" a kid inserts a plastic
figurine into a cradle (attached to the computer through USB). The system
reacts by opening different web pages, depending on which character is
used. Figures include Barney, Bob the Builder, and other popular
children's characters.

Tangible media have long been a favorite topic of academic researchers in
HCI, and it makes sense to target preliterate users for early commercial
designs with these physical interaction devices.

iPHONE AND MOBILE WEB

Dave Winer reviews the iPhone after a month's use, providing deeper
insights than most reviews, since many issues in mobile user experience
only become clear after sustained use in multiple contexts.

Dave's conclusion: Blackberry still "outshines Apple's product."

For most companies it doesn't matter whether Blackberry, iPhone, or the
next Nokia device is the best PDA. Your mobile sites MUST WORK ON ALL
MOBILE PLATFORMS that are used by any decent percentage of your customers.
(Just as it doesn't matter what market share Firefox has relative to IE:
as long as Firefox is above 2%, your regular site must work on that
browser, or you're throwing away too many customers.)

What's important is the strategy for how customers should access your
mobile services. There are two main choices:

  * your regular website, made accessible for mobile devices
  * a special version of your key services, optimized for mobile

This choice between ACCESSIBILITY (barely working user experience) and
OPTIMIZATION (good user experience) is exactly the same as companies have
for supporting users with disabilities. The main difference is that vastly
more money is at stake for mobile strategy than the amount you'll make
from selling to blind customers and people with other disabilities (each
of which requires its own design for full optimization of those users'
UE). More on this dilemma:

Halfway down his article, Dave Winer states his conclusion: accessing
regular websites on a mobile "isn't going to work," even with as big a
screen as the iPhone.

There has been some debate about this point, with a Forrester report
claiming that the iPhone eliminates the need for "stripped down sites
crammed onto the small screens of devices meant for phoning, not
browsing."

I am on Dave Winer's side in this debate: I too think that services need
to be designed for mobile to provide a satisfactory user experience.

There are two reasons to side with Winer: 

First, he is the one who has the user experience credentials.

Second, using a tiny screen and slow connection is a very painful way to
access websites designed for big-screen desktop PCs. Remember using
websites on 640x480 and a modem connection? iPhone only gives you half of
that, and screens are unlikely to get much bigger as long as they need to
be mobile, and thus handheld. Designing a scaled-back UI is a vastly
superior way of supporting real-world mobile user tasks, such as executing
stock trades, checking the weather forecast, or buying a book.
